"sudo rm /bin/kill"이 kill 실행 파일을 삭제하지 않는 이유

"sudo rm /bin/kill"이 kill 실행 파일을 삭제하지 않는 이유

sudo rm /bin/kill명령 을 삭제하기 위해 Ubuntu VM에서 실행을 시도했습니다 kill. 실행하면 which kill파일이 존재하지 않는 것처럼 출력이 나오지 않지만 실행하면 kill완벽하게 작동합니까?

kill실행 파일을 삭제한 후에도 여전히 작동하는 이유는 무엇입니까 ?

답변1

발행하면 type kill응답은 다음과 같습니다.

kill is a shell builtin

Kill은 bash 쉘 자체에 포함되어 있습니다.

다른 프로그램을 호출하지 않고 쉘에서 직접 실행됩니다.

bash 쉘 내의 모든 명령을 알고 싶다면 help | less.

관련 정보